Public Hearing

            Continued: HH 2016-08 Certificate of Appropriateness (COA) has been received for Brooks Park at 1 Oak Street, Map 41 Parcel C6 in the R-R, and HC-HD Zones. The application is pursuant to MGL c. 40.C, §6 and the Code of the Town of Harwich c.131 Historic Preservation, Article I.  Specifically, the proposal seeks approval for a new 16’ x 34’ Pavilion through the phased development plan for the Park. Owner, Town of Harwich Selectmen, c/o Applicant, Eric Beebe, Recreation Director.

 

Continued: HH 2016-14 Notice of Intent (NOI) to demolish structures over 100 years old, has been received for property located at 24 Mill Road, Map 15 Parcel U19 in the R-L Zone. The application is pursuant to the Code of the Town of Harwich §131-8 and proposes a 100% demolition of the c. 1790 Cape style home to allow for new construction.  John Robbie Jr. TR/ Jennifer Robbie, owner/applicant

 

HH 2016-15 Notice of Intent (NOI) to demolish structures over 100 years old, has been received for property located at 2267 Route 28 - Head of the Bay Road, Map 119, Parcel N6, in the CH-1 Zone. The application is pursuant to the Code of the Town of Harwich §131-8 Historically Significant Buildings.  The applicant proposes 100% demolition of the c.1890 Cape Cod Colonial style dwelling to allow for new construction. David D. and Kimberly J. Sterling, owners/applicants.

 

HH 2016-16 Certificate of Appropriateness (COA) has been received for 328 Bank Street, Map 41, Parcel N4, in the C-V, H-C and HC-HD Zones. The application is pursuant to MGL c. 40C, §6 and the Code of the Town of Harwich c.131 Historic Preservation, Article I - Historic District.  The owner(s) seek approval for of a new sign for the accessory building commonly known as 119 Parallel Street. Royal Assisted Living I, LLC, owner/applicant.
